Landesteile
Landesteile
Ein Ort ist einem Landesteil zugeordnet; in Deutschland sind dies die Bundesländer, in Frankreich die Departements, usw.. Für diesen soll nun noch die jeweilige Haupstadt gespeichert werden. Für Rheinland-Pfalz wäre das z.B. Mainz.
Aufgabe 1
- Erkläre, warum man dafür eine neue Tabelle
landteil
benötigt. - Welche Attribute (mit welchem Datentyp) benötigt die Tabelle?
Entwerfe die neue Tabelle zunächst auf einem Arbeitsblatt:
Aufgabe 2
In der Regel gibt es für jeden Landesteil eine Hauptstadt.
Erweitere die Tabelle landteil
, so dass diese Information gespeichert werden kann.
Aufgabe 3
In der neuen Tabelle landteil
könnte auch ein Attribut LNR
vorgesehen werden -
du hast es vielleicht auf dem Arbeitsblatt schon gesehen und benutzt.
- Erkläre, wozu das Attribut dient.
- Welche Anpassungen benötigt dann die Tabelle
ort
? - Für Experten: Eigentlich sind jetzt überflüssige (redundante) Beziehungen entstanden. Wo sind diese?
Wenn du die Exkurs-Kapitel zuvor verstanden hast, kannst du die neue Tabelle in SQLite auch selbst einmal anlegen.
Quellen
- [1]: Bundesländer in Deutschland(letzter Zugriff: 19.02.2024) - Urheber: David Liuzzo - Lizenz: Creative Commons BY-SA 2.0